Key Concepts and Overview

Load balancing is the process of distributing network traffic across multiple servers to ensure no single server bears too much load. This is essential for online casinos, where high traffic volumes can lead to slow response times or even server crashes. The core idea is to optimize resource use, maximize throughput, minimize response time, and avoid overload on any single resource. By implementing effective load balancing techniques, online gambling platforms can enhance their reliability and provide a better experience for players, especially during peak hours when demand surges.

Main Features and Details

There are several key components and techniques involved in load balancing for slot servers:

  • Round Robin: This method distributes requests sequentially across all available servers. It’s simple and effective for evenly distributing traffic.
  • Least Connections: This technique directs traffic to the server with the fewest active connections, ensuring that no single server becomes a bottleneck.
  • IP Hashing: This method uses the IP address of the client to determine which server will handle the request, ensuring that a user is consistently directed to the same server.
  • Health Checks: Regular monitoring of server health is crucial. Load balancers can automatically reroute traffic away from servers that are down or underperforming.
  • Session Persistence: Also known as sticky sessions, this technique ensures that a user’s session is consistently handled by the same server, which is important for maintaining game states in online gambling.

Practical Examples and Use Cases

Consider a scenario where an online casino experiences a surge in traffic during a major sporting event. With thousands of players logging in to place bets and play slots, a well-implemented load balancing strategy can make all the difference. For instance, using the Least Connections method, the system can direct new players to the server that is currently handling the least number of active sessions, ensuring that everyone has a fair chance of accessing the games without delays.

Another example could be during a promotional event where a casino offers bonuses for slot games. The increased traffic can be effectively managed by employing Round Robin load balancing, which distributes the incoming requests evenly across all servers, thus preventing any single server from crashing under pressure.

Advantages and Disadvantages

Like any technology, load balancing has its pros and cons:

  • Advantages:
    • Improved reliability and uptime, as traffic is distributed across multiple servers.
    • Enhanced user experience with reduced latency and faster response times.
    • Scalability, allowing casinos to add more servers as traffic increases.
  • Disadvantages:
    • Complexity in setup and management, requiring skilled IT personnel.
    • Potential for increased costs due to additional hardware and software requirements.
    • Risk of misconfiguration, which can lead to uneven traffic distribution and server overload.
